We are on a mission to assist a billion Indians in their spiritual journey and help them feel happier, peaceful & more content.
Our flagship product, Sri Mandir is the world’s largest app for Hindu devotees. It serves as a digital sanctuary for millions of devotees worldwide. Through our app, users can seamlessly participate in online pujas, make chadhava (offerings), and connect with various temples across the country, bringing divine blessings to their lives.
